3. Konfigurazioa

3.1 Bolantea muntatzea

  1. Ensure your racing rig or desk is stable and clean.
  2. Attach the MOZA CS Steering Wheel to your compatible wheel base using the provided quick-release mechanism or mounting screws. Refer to your wheel base manual for specific attachment instructions.
  3. Erabileran zehar mugimendua saihesteko, estutu ondo konexio guztiak.

3.2 PCra konektatzea

  1. Connect the USB cable from the wheel base (or wheel, if direct connection) to an available USB port on your PC.
  2. Connect the power adapter to the wheel base and then to a power outlet.
  3. Power on your PC.

4. Funtzionamendu-argibideak

4.1 Hasierako Kalibrazioa

After installing the software, perform an initial calibration of the steering wheel. This typically involves turning the wheel to its full left and right lock, and pressing the pedals (if connected) to their full range. Follow the on-screen prompts within the MOZA software.

4.2 Button and Paddle Functions

The MOZA CS Steering Wheel features multiple programmable buttons and paddle shifters. These can be mapped to in-game functions such as gear shifting, DRS activation, pit limiter, and more. Refer to your game's control settings and the MOZA software for customization options.

4.3 Force Feedback Settings

Adjust force feedback intensity and effects through the MOZA software. Experiment with different settings to find the optimal feel for various racing titles and personal preference. Incorrect settings may lead to discomfort or reduced performance.

5.2 Biltegiratzea

When not in use, store the steering wheel in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ures. If detaching from the wheel base, store it in its original packaging or a protective case to prevent dust accumulation and physical damage.
